在数字化时代,将图片转换成动漫风格的作品是一种非常受欢迎的创意活动。无论是为了个人兴趣还是职业需求,掌握这种技能都能让你的作品更加生动有趣。下面,我将带领你从零开始,逐步学习如何将图片变成精美的动漫风格作品。
了解动漫风格
在开始动手之前,先了解一些常见的动漫风格是非常重要的。动漫风格多种多样,从可爱的卡通到逼真的插画,每一种风格都有其独特的特点。以下是一些常见的动漫风格:
- 卡通风格:线条简单,色彩鲜艳,适合儿童或年轻受众。
- 插画风格:注重细节,色彩丰富,适合追求艺术感的人群。
- 写实风格:追求真实感,人物和场景的细节丰富,适合喜欢真实感的人。
准备工具
为了将图片转换成动漫风格,你需要以下工具:
- 图像处理软件:如Adobe Photoshop、GIMP、Corel Painter等。
- 矢量图形软件(可选):如Adobe Illustrator,用于制作线条和形状。
转换步骤
步骤一:选择合适的图片
选择一张清晰、色彩丰富的图片作为转换的基础。最好选择高分辨率的图片,以便在转换过程中有更多的细节处理空间。
步骤二:调整图像色彩
使用图像处理软件调整图片的色彩平衡,使其更适合动漫风格。你可以通过调整色阶、曲线等工具来实现。
步骤三:简化图像细节
动漫风格通常需要简化图像细节。使用橡皮擦工具或图层蒙版隐藏不必要的细节,保留主要的轮廓和特征。
步骤四:添加线条和阴影
使用钢笔工具或矢量图形软件绘制线条,为角色添加轮廓。然后,使用阴影和光影效果增强立体感。
步骤五:上色
选择合适的颜色为角色上色。动漫风格的颜色通常较为鲜艳和对比度较高。可以使用图层和混合模式来创造丰富的视觉效果。
步骤六:细节处理
在完成基本的上色后,回到细节处理。检查线条是否流畅,阴影是否自然,颜色是否和谐。
实例讲解
以下是一个简单的实例,展示如何使用Photoshop将一张普通照片转换成动漫风格:
# 假设我们有一个名为 "original_image.jpg" 的图像文件
from PIL import Image
import numpy as np
import cv2
# 读取图片
original_image = Image.open("original_image.jpg")
# 转换为灰度图
gray_image = original_image.convert("L")
# 应用阈值处理,简化图像
threshold = 128
binary_image = gray_image.point(lambda p: p > threshold and 255)
# 保存转换后的图像
binary_image.save("anime_style_image.jpg")
这个简单的Python脚本使用了PIL库来读取和处理图像。它将原始图像转换为灰度图,然后应用阈值处理来简化图像,最后保存转换后的图像。
总结
通过以上步骤,你可以将普通图片转换成具有动漫风格的精美作品。当然,这只是一个基础的指南,实际操作中可能需要根据具体情况调整步骤和方法。不断实践和学习,你会逐渐掌握更多高级技巧,创作出更加独特和吸引人的动漫风格作品。
